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,350,035,066
Lastest Block:
2,007,321
Utxos:
1,982,658
Nodes:
314
OmniXEP Contracts:
281
Block details
[STAKE]
26/06/2025 14:09:20 UTC
Txid
1da2c72f52f1d45758ba1868f2ffbd13766ed28a743d3ada0efb2ce0698d7c0b
Block
1,774,264
Block hash
b8e1a800d9fffe09a64270cd6bd29c3ab2c17a223c74642bb35750ba4b944a58
Stake amount
152.13843275 XEP
Sender
ep1q6lumjcca5uchx36uc2ksr0zhudspc8qm8sfdnr
Recipient
ep1qeyxy8zktzahh2vzm4ata7q24yhjdfy2ty39s4h
(2,533,620.74198902 XEP)